Complete answer:
Save as otherwise offered in this Constitution, all queries at any sedentary of either House or joint sedentary of the Houses shall be regulated by a majority of votes of the affiliates in attendance and voting, other than the Speaker or person substitute as Chairman or Speaker. The Chairman or Speaker, or person substituting as such, shall not vote in the initial occurrence, but shall have and implement a casting vote in the case of equivalence of votes. The quorum of the Lok Sabha and the Rajya Sabha is one-tenth of the overall affiliation of each house. The quorum to establish a sedentary of the House is one-tenth of the overall number of affiliates of the House, for both Lok Sabha as well as Rajya Sabha. If there is no quorum, it shall be the responsibility of the chairman or speaker to suspend the house or adjourn the meeting. The Constitution has set one-tenth potency as a quorum for both Lok Sabha and Rajya Sabha. The tenure of individual affiliates is 6 years. Unpremeditated positions, whenever happening, are filled through bye-elections for the residual tenure only.
Thus, option (D) is correct.
Note: If at any time throughout a meeting of a House there is no quorum, it shall be the responsibility of the chairman or Speaker, or person substituting as such, either to suspend the House or to adjourn the meeting until there is a quorum.
